  • Abstract
    In this paper, a new system for parcel map conversion and management is proposed. A scanner was used to input paper source maps into a computer. Text is separated from graphics by finding a connected component. Thinning and tracing are then executed by utilizing run-length codes for straight line extraction. A program is found if a closed loop is detected. All the extracted objects are stored into a spatial database. Attribute data such as land number, land use label, and land owner are saved into an attribute database. Topology representing the relations among objects is also generated and saved into the attribute database. We can query attribute data by spatial data and vice versa. A3 size parcel maps and Taipei administrative map are tested. The experimental results show that the proposed system is very effective and friendly
